#2f38cb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f38cb is composed of 18.4% red, 22%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.8% cyan, 72.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 236.5 degrees, a saturation of 62.4% and a lightness of 49%. #2f38cb color hex could be obtained by blending #5e70ff with #000097.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#2f38cb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f38cb has RGB values of R:47, G:56, B:203 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 3094731.

Shades and Tints of #2f38cb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03030c is the darkest color, while #fbf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f38cb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7c7e is the less saturated color, while #0916f1 is the most saturated one.
